Transaction 77364a809e2f348346e699088ec5aede4a99b2bc84bed39e4a22e45744c2b419

2 Input
2 Outputs
  • 77364a809e2f348346e699088ec5aede4a99b2bc84bed39e4a22e45744c2b419:0
  • value  67416
    address  15KKAabFxhEUDkbXwairjpvwTZo9pqMvEY
  • 77364a809e2f348346e699088ec5aede4a99b2bc84bed39e4a22e45744c2b419:1
  • value  26800000
    address  3672cngCaXMJHjwRjS34GBY1jgBNjNhZ4k